The Engine of AI Hardware Demand

As the global technology landscape undergoes a massive transformation, the demand for Artificial Intelligence (AI) hardware has become the core engine driving the semiconductor industry. TSMC's latest financial results indicate that its second-quarter revenue has hit a historic high. This stellar performance is primarily attributed to the sustained global demand for High-Performance Computing (HPC) chips and AI processors. According to reports from Livemint, TSMC recorded a staggering 68% surge in June revenues, underscoring the relentless momentum in the AI hardware supply chain.

Financial Growth and Technical Drivers

Analyzing the financial metrics, TSMC's sales growth for the year has been remarkable, reaching a 36% year-on-year increase. This is not merely a benefit of technology cycles but a reflection of TSMC's absolute dominance in advanced process nodes, such as 3nm and 5nm. As major tech giants race to expand their AI data center footprints, TSMC, as the world's most critical foundry, has maintained extremely high capacity utilization rates, providing a solid foundation for its revenue growth.

Impact on the Industry Ecosystem

TSMC's growth represents more than just the success of a single enterprise; it serves as a microcosm for the entire AI ecosystem. As AI models continue to scale in parameters, the requirements for chip compute density and energy efficiency have become increasingly stringent, making TSMC's advanced packaging technologies—such as CoWoS—an indispensable choice for customers. Market analysts point out that TSMC's success lies in its ability to translate cutting-edge scientific research into mass-production capabilities, establishing its position as the "cornerstone" of the AI era.

Regulatory and Geopolitical Considerations

Despite strong financial performance, TSMC must navigate the geopolitical challenges arising from global supply chain restructuring. Governments worldwide are increasingly demanding self-reliance in semiconductor supply chains, forcing TSMC to diversify its production footprint across multiple countries. While these initiatives increase operational costs, they are strategic moves to mitigate regional supply risks and ensure long-term bargaining power in the global market.
